Understanding On-Site Consultation

On-site consultation is a critical step in the paver service industry, allowing professionals to assess the specific needs of a project directly at the location. This process involves evaluating the site conditions, understanding the client’s vision, and determining the best materials and techniques to use. By conducting an on-site consultation, service providers can gather essential information that will inform their recommendations and ensure a successful project outcome.

Preparing for the Consultation

Before heading to the site, it’s vital to prepare adequately. This includes reviewing any preliminary information provided by the client, such as project goals, budget constraints, and timelines. Additionally, bringing along necessary tools, such as measuring devices and samples of paver materials, can facilitate a more productive discussion. Preparation sets the stage for a thorough and efficient consultation process.

Conducting the Site Assessment

During the on-site consultation, the first step is to conduct a comprehensive site assessment. This involves examining the terrain, existing structures, drainage systems, and any potential obstacles that could affect the installation of pavers. By identifying these factors early on, professionals can propose solutions that align with the site’s unique characteristics, ensuring durability and aesthetic appeal.

Engaging with the Client

Effective communication with the client is paramount during the consultation. Listening to their ideas, preferences, and concerns helps build rapport and trust. It’s essential to ask open-ended questions that encourage clients to express their vision for the project. This engagement not only clarifies their expectations but also allows the consultant to tailor their recommendations accordingly.

Discussing Design Options

Once the site assessment is complete, the next step is to discuss design options with the client. Presenting various paver styles, colors, and patterns can inspire creativity and help clients visualize the final outcome. Utilizing design software or samples can enhance this discussion, making it easier for clients to make informed decisions about their project.

Evaluating Budget and Timeline

Budget and timeline considerations are crucial components of the on-site consultation. It’s important to discuss the estimated costs associated with different materials and designs, as well as the overall project timeline. By being transparent about these factors, clients can make choices that align with their financial and scheduling constraints, leading to a smoother project execution.

Identifying Potential Challenges

Every project comes with its own set of challenges, and identifying these during the consultation can save time and resources later on. Discussing potential issues such as site accessibility, weather conditions, and local regulations ensures that both the client and the service provider are prepared for any obstacles that may arise. Proactive problem-solving is key to a successful paver installation.

Providing Recommendations

After gathering all necessary information, it’s time to provide tailored recommendations to the client. This includes suggesting specific paver materials, installation techniques, and maintenance practices. By offering expert advice based on the site assessment and client preferences, service providers can position themselves as trusted advisors, enhancing client satisfaction and loyalty.

Documenting the Consultation

Documenting the details of the on-site consultation is essential for future reference. This includes notes on client preferences, site conditions, and agreed-upon recommendations. Providing a summary to the client not only reinforces the information discussed but also serves as a valuable reference point as the project progresses. Clear documentation helps maintain transparency and accountability throughout the project lifecycle.

Following Up After the Consultation

Finally, following up with the client after the consultation is a best practice that can strengthen the client relationship. This could involve sending a thank-you note, providing additional information, or answering any lingering questions. A proactive follow-up demonstrates professionalism and commitment to client satisfaction, paving the way for a successful project and potential future collaborations.
